Palestinians Rally in Gaza to Honor Martyrs and Affirm Continued Resistance

 


Thousands of Palestinians gathered in the Gaza Strip to commemorate the martyrs of the recent aggression by the occupying Israeli entity, vowing to persist in their resistance against the occupation. 


The demonstration took place in Gaza City as a tribute to the more than 30 Palestinians who lost their lives during the entity's relentless airstrikes on the coastal territory earlier this month.


The Israeli entity initiated a series of deadly bombings on May 9, prompting the Islamic Jihad, a resistance group based in Gaza, to retaliate by launching over 1,000 rockets towards the occupied territories. This conflict marked the most intense episode of fighting between Gaza's resistance factions and the Israeli entity since the 10-day war imposed on the blockaded territory in 2021. After five days of hostilities, a ceasefire brokered by Egypt came into effect on Saturday night.


During the Friday commemoration event, Khaled Al-Batsh, the leader of Islamic Jihad, paid tribute to the group's commanders who were killed in targeted assassination operations carried out by the Israeli forces during the recent onslaught. Al-Batsh stated, "Today, Islamic Jihad holds this ceremony to honor its martyrs and leaders, including Khalil Al-Bahtini, Jihad Ghannam, Tareq Ezzedine, Khadder Adnan, Ali Ghali, Ahmed Abu Dakka, Eyad Al Hasani, and all the martyrs of our people."


He further conveyed a powerful message, saying, "We want to convey to the entire world that despite the F-16 airstrikes and the barrage of rockets fired upon us, our nation is still resilient and will continue its resistance. We assert our right to freedom. 


From the blood of our martyrs, we draw strength to confront the Zionists. We will persist in our struggle."
